Redis 主从复制

============ Redis 主从复制:确保三台机器安装了相同版本的redis ============

1、建立一台master,前面的在Linux下安装redis流程

2、拷贝两台从,【scp -r redis-3.0.7/ 192.168.56.102:/usr/local/】,拷贝master的文件进行修改

3、删除日志文件:【rm -f dump.rdb】

4、修改slave配置文件:【vim redis.conf】,添加下面信息
# slaveof  
【slaveod 192.168.56.101 6379】

5、配置文件修改密码(如果master有密码则设置):【masterauth root -123456】

6、关闭防火墙:【yum install iptables-services】-->【service iptables stop】

7、关闭seLinux:修改/etc/selinux/config 文件,将SELINUX=enforcing改为SELINUX=disabled ,重启机器即

8、找到redis.conf中的 bind 127.0.0.1,将其注释 #bind 127.0.0.1,保存退出

8、使用【info】或【info replication 】127.0.0.1:6379> info , 可以查看Replication的一些信息

关于Linux防火墙和 SELinux的一些操作

 ======== 防火墙 ========

1、临时关闭防火墙 :【systemctl stop firewalld】

2、永久防火墙开机自关闭 :【systemctl disable firewalld】

3、临时打开防火墙 :【systemctl start firewalld】

4、防火墙开机启动 :【systemctl enable firewalld】

5、查看防火墙状态 :【systemctl status firewalld】

 ======== SELinux ========
 
1、临时关闭SELinux:【setenforce 0】

2、临时打开SELinux :【setenforce 1】

3、查看SELinux状态 :【getenforce】

4、开机关闭SELinux:【修改/etc/selinux/config 文件,将SELINUX=enforcing改为SELINUX=disabled ,重启机器即】

 

你可能感兴趣的:(redis)